Perched on the plateau of a cliff bordering the Devil's River, the Russel Cliff is a chic, contemporary and welcoming chalet. From the mid-level entrance, you have a view of all the common living spaces dedicated to entertainment and gatherings with family or friends.

The ground floor, with its south-facing windows, is literally flooded with light. The huge common room on this floor is made up of the laboratory kitchen with granite countertop and its large pantry, the dining room overlooking the Devil's River and the living room decorated with a slow combustion fireplace and cathedral ceiling. and its exposed beams.
A large patio door gives access to the terrace adjacent to the kitchen/dining room where BBQ evenings are in the spotlight.
The second portion of the ground floor is made up of the master bedroom with a king bed and a large walk-in closet connecting it to the magnificent private bathroom offering a radiant floor, a “deposited” bath, a fully glazed shower as well as a vanity with two sinks.
On the garden level, you will find the family room with 50” TV and foosball table. You will also find two bedrooms. One with two Queen beds and the other with a Queen bed. A full bathroom with laundry room is also on this level. The patio door gives you access to the private SPA and the land overlooking the La Diable River.

It is essential to have a vehicle to move around.
During winter, it is mandatory to have good winter tires or 4X4 cars to go up the driveway.
PARKING FEATURES:
In winter, only 4x4 cars can park near the chalet. There is space for 2-3 cars at the top of the driveway. Note that overnight parking is prohibited on the street from November 15 to April 1. For those who can park at the bottom, note that it is preferable to go down the driveway backwards to be able to go up more easily from the front. You must park so as not to block access to the driveway for the snowplow in the event of a snow shower.
